The Vokera part is based around the diverter valve section. The diverter valve is a device that only appears in combi boilers. It allows the hot water to be directed to the central heating system (radiators, etc.) or to the domestic hot water system (taps, etc.). This feature is what separates a normal boiler from a combi boiler due to the fact that a combi boiler wouldn't require a cylinder to provide heating and hot water.
